A South Carolina lottery player turned a simple stop for a soda into a life-changing moment when all four of her scratch-off tickets won prizes, including a $200,000 top prize. The remarkable South Carolina lottery win happened in Liberty, where the woman bought four consecutive $5 scratch-off tickets and ended up going four-for-four.
According to lottery officials, the lucky player stopped at Stop-A-Minit #12 on West Main Street with $20 in hand and decided to use it on four tickets from the $5 “Neon Jackpot” scratch-off game. What happened next was surprisingly rare: every ticket was a winner.
The first two tickets returned her original money, while the third delivered a $10 prize. Then came the big finish — the fourth ticket revealed a $200,000 top prize. Understandably, the winner said the moment still hadn’t fully sunk in.
For her, the biggest impact goes beyond the excitement of a lucky streak. She now plans to use the six-figure lottery prize to buy a new home, turning a routine purchase into a major financial milestone.
Because the winning ticket was sold at Stop-A-Minit #12 in Liberty, the retailer also received a $2,000 commission from the South Carolina Lottery.
What to Know About the Neon Jackpot Scratch-Off Game
The winning ticket came from the South Carolina Lottery’s “Neon Jackpot” scratch-off game, a $5 instant ticket that launched in September 2025. Originally, the game offered four top prizes of $200,000.
At the time of the announcement, one $200,000 top prize was still unclaimed. Lottery officials also reported that 124 of 279 second-tier prizes worth $1,000 and 446 of 1,054 third-tier prizes worth $500 were still available.

Expert Insight
This win is a great reminder of how scratch-off games are structured: smaller wins often appear more frequently, but top prizes are extremely rare. Even though this player won on four straight tickets, that kind of streak should be seen as an outlier, not a pattern players can expect to repeat.
A useful takeaway for lottery players is to check prize-remaining data before buying scratch-offs. If a game still has top prizes and a healthy number of mid-tier prizes left, some players see that as a better value opportunity than older games with most major prizes already claimed. No wonder experienced players often pay close attention to prize tables, launch dates, and remaining jackpot counts before choosing a ticket.
